Food & Beverage service
*There is no free breakfast amenity at this property for Marriott Bonvoy Platinum/Titanium/Ambassador.*
(Dec 2022) There is also no 'elite hour' (i.e. Happy Hour) or daily 'afternoon tea'.

Transfer Prices
Shared Speedboat (45mins) - $901 per adult, $339 per child 3-11, 2 and under free
Private 48' Speedboat - $2800 per person
Yacht transfer no longer offered as a paid option as of February 2022, but there are reports of the
hotel offering it at their discretion
Shared Seaplane (10 mins) - $1,400 per adult, $700 per child 3-11, 2 and under free
Private Seaplane - $9.500
This cost applies to all guests, regardless of cash booking vs. points booking.
All prices are roundtrip, before 23.2% tax. See this website for latest updated

Miscellaneous
Island time: The resort has the clock set one hour ahead of Malé, so the time is GMT +6 hours. Many resorts in the Maldives do this for sunset viewing purposes.

Just wrapping up a great stay here, titanium points stay for 6 nights. Got upgraded to a lagoon view, so we've had a hot pool and limited wind. The wind is subject to change so check before arrival.
re the 20% discount this was honoured instantly when we mentioned it to the butler on arrival, I believe this is because we booked in 2021, Staff at all the restaurants required prompting to apply it sometimes but it was never argued about.
Elite hour has free drinks and cocktails for an hour and really makes up for the lack of free breakfast.
